I take down walls myself. I don't need a contractor to do the job as I am pretty darn good at stuff like that. Same goes for electrical.
The next rendition of the kitchen will include a 78 sq.ft. addition that will fill in a space that should have been part of the original construction. I will add a nook and a floor to ceiling cabinet. As you suggested, I plan to add more work space under good lighting.
The contractor cut corners building my home. He supported a 12 foot bearing wall header with only one 2X4 on either end, which I discovered and corrected during a remodel of my living room. He also tied a lot of wiring circuits together so that he could save on wire and breakers.
